Why Timing Can Matter as Much as Comparison Shopping
Camera pricing in this market isn’t static. Between currency fluctuations, new model releases, and seasonal promotional periods, the same camera can genuinely cost noticeably different amounts depending on when you choose to buy, independent of which retailer you select.
Understanding Camera Price in Pakistan Sony Fluctuation Patterns
Currency-Driven Price Movement
Since camera equipment is imported and priced based on international currency values, local retailers frequently adjust pricing in response to exchange rate shifts, sometimes on a near-daily basis according to their own posted updates.
New Model Release Timing
When a manufacturer announces a new model within an existing product line, pricing on the outgoing version often becomes more competitive shortly afterward, as retailers work to clear existing inventory ahead of newer stock arriving.
Why Waiting for a Successor Announcement Can Pay Off
Buyers who aren’t specifically chasing the very latest features can often find meaningfully better value by watching for successor model announcements and timing their purchase of the previous generation accordingly.
Seasonal and Promotional Windows
Retailers occasionally run discounts tied to major shopping seasons or clearance events, making these periods worth monitoring if your purchase timeline has some flexibility.
Comparing Shopping Channels
Authorized Retailers and Official Dealers
Purchasing through established, authorized camera retailers typically provides genuine product assurance and reliable local warranty coverage, which can justify a somewhat higher price compared to less formal alternatives.
Online Marketplaces and Classifieds
Broader online marketplaces sometimes offer more competitive pricing through individual sellers or smaller shops, though this generally requires more careful verification of seller reputation and product authenticity.
Secondhand and Used Equipment Markets
Given how mature much of the current camera lineup is, an active secondhand market exists for many models, often offering substantial savings for buyers comfortable purchasing carefully inspected used equipment.

Negotiation and Value-Add Strategies
Asking About Bundled Accessories
Some retailers are willing to include a memory card, spare battery, or camera bag at a discounted combined rate, even when the base camera price itself isn’t flexible.
Inquiring About Payment Method Discounts
Certain retailers offer reduced pricing for bank transfer or other non-cash payment methods, making it worth asking directly rather than assuming the listed price is entirely fixed.
